Job description

Job responsibilities

See briefing pack for further details

Dispensary Duties

To carry out the validation, labelling, dispensing and issue of prescriptions in the outpatient pharmacy

To calculate varying degrees of complex doses and quantities to supply on prescriptions

To undertake an in-process accuracy check of assembled prescribed items prior to the final accuracy check

To work on the pharmacy outpatient reception, taking in and handing out prescriptions, taking payment and dealing with customer queries

Use the Electronic Patient Record system to locate and print outpatient prescriptions

To securely and accurately input data, patient and prescription details onto the computer system and assist with the maintenance of records relating to work and workload statistics

To participate in the ordering, receipt of goods, stock checks and stock control of medicines in the outpatient pharmacy, ensuring efficient use of pharmaceuticals and resources

To assist with the dispensing, recording, maintenance, issue and receipt of Controlled Drugs as appropriate

To work under the supervision of site pharmacy manager within the outpatient dispensary to ensure efficient workflow and pharmacy provision

To carry out general duties, including stock and preparation of bottles, sundry items, additional information and labels, packaging, and counting and cleaning equipment

To use the prescription tracking system to record patient information and monitor and audit the transit of prescriptions through the dispensing, checking and delivery processes

  • To assist with the monitoring of the till to enable the team to process transactions efficiently
  • To monitor and record safe storage of stock by carrying out environmental temperature checks, expiry date checking, stock checks and assisting in the rotation of stock
  • To clean shelving where pharmaceuticals are stored, keeping them in a tidy, organised and fit for purpose condition

Communication

To provide / receive routine information that may require tact or persuasive skills where there may be difficulties in understanding, especially when answering the telephone

To provide medication information verbally or in written format to outpatients or their representatives

General Duties

  • To work flexibly to support the team and service needs
  • To adhere to all policies and procedures for CHS and CHFT
  • To complete all mandatory training
  • To participate in and contribute towards an annual individual appraisal, with the dual goals of enhancing performance and developing a personal development plan
  • To carry out duties with due regard to the Trusts Equal Opportunity policy
  • To seek advice and support from Line Manager whenever necessary
  • To maintain professional conduct including appearance at all times

Person Specification

Qualifications

Essential

  • GCSE English and Mathematics passed at grade 4 to 9 (or equivalent)
  • Completed NVQ level 2 in Pharmacy Service Skills / BTEC Level 2 certificate in Pharmaceutical Science (QCF) or equivalent Pharmacy Assistant course approved by GPhC

Knowledge & Skill

Essential

  • Excellent customer service skills
  • Calm and professional manner under pressure
  • Flexible, enthusiastic approach
  • Evidence of good team working and interpersonal skills
  • Able to pay meticulous attention to detai
  • Able to understand and follow written procedures
  • Demonstrate good oral and written communication skills
  • Excellent interpersonal skills - able to form positive relationships
  • Organised, tidy and methodical
  • Able to clearly and accurately complete routine documentation
  • Able to deal with frequent interruptions, stressful situations or changing priorities whilst completing planned work
  • Reliable, trustworthy and punctual
  • Keyboard skills. Able to use basic Microsoft Office application
  • Demonstrate accurate numeracy skills, without using a calculator, including - Simple calculations e.g. Addition, subtraction, division and multiplication; and Percentages, decimal, fractions and ratios

Desirable

  • Able to deal with difficult, angry, annoyed patients and/or healthcare colleagues

Experience

Essential

  • Experience of direct customer facing contact
  • Able to work under pressure in a busy environment
  • Experience as a Pharmacy Assistant

Desirable

  • Experience working in the hospital environment
